Priceless Memorabilia Stolen From Scott Frost's Lincoln Home

Over a dozen championship rings and other priceless pieces of memorabilia have been stolen from Nebraska football coach Scott Frost's home.

Monday morning, Lincoln Police announced that roughly $165,000 worth of memorabilia was taken from the southwest Lincoln home over the weekend. The house is currently under renovation and investigators believe the thieves got in through and unlocked garage door. 

Stolen items include two Husker championship rings, ten Oregon Ducks championship rings, two University of Central Florida championship rings, five pairs of Oregon Ducks Air Jordan shoes and a black Nintendo Wii console.
